How does Diemer Renovations LLC phase kitchen and bathroom projects to match a homeowner budget?
For kitchens and baths, Diemer Renovations LLC typically begins with layout goals, must‑have upgrades, and timing expectations. From there, the team sequences work into logical stages: preparation and protective coverings, selective demolition, essential repairs to drywall or subfloors, then cabinetry and countertop upgrades, followed by tile, plumbing trim, lighting, paint, and final punch. Homeowners can pause after any stage, enabling careful review before committing to the next step. Cabinet improvements may start with hardware, soft‑close adjustments, or refinishing, then move to partial or full replacement when the budget and schedule align. Countertops can be upgraded in a dedicated phase with coordinated sink and faucet swaps to limit downtime. Finishes are timed last to protect fresh surfaces and reduce rework. This stepwise approach narrows unknowns, keeps key fixtures operational where possible, and aligns each investment with a comfortable spending plan without compromising the final look or function.
What paint stain and finishing services does Diemer Renovations LLC offer inside and out?
Paint, stain, and finishing work shape the first impression of a home and the durability of daily surfaces. Diemer Renovations LLC prepares interiors with careful masking, drywall patching, caulking, priming, and uniform sheen control so walls, ceilings, trim, and doors read as a cohesive whole. On exteriors, the crew prioritizes cleaning and surface stabilization, then selects coatings suited to local weather for siding, fences, and gates. Cabinetry receives specialized attention through refinishing or color shifts that pair well with planned countertop updates. Stain selections are tested for tone and clarity, while low‑odor coatings can be specified to keep living spaces comfortable during work. Finishing tasks are often phased by room or elevation, allowing high‑traffic areas to be refreshed first and outdoor work to align with favorable conditions. The outcome is a consistent, durable finish that supports broader remodeling goals and stretches value across each step.
